The menu of the hotel restaurant was needed for the dining scene to take place. However, another layer of interpretation is intentionally added in the prop for the featuring of Boy with an Apple painting, which is a relevant piece in the film, but an element yet to be introduced in the story. In fact, the painting plays a central role in the story, but in the menu, a watercolor reproduction is intentionally featured instead of a photographic copy, giving the impression that it was created as a tribute to the original.
